Portage County Public Health Emergency Preparedness Planning

The Portage County Health District is working with our county emergency response partners to ensure citizens are protected if a bioterrorism attack, disease outbreak or natural disaster happens in our community. These events could have long term impact on the community’s health and safety and disrupt our daily routines.

During a public health emergency information will be posted on this website for response and recovery.

Be Prepared

Be Informed:

  • Learn what to do before, during and after a disaster
  • Learn how to teach others to turn off electricity, gas, and water
  • Update insurance policies
  • Know how fire extinguishers work (check fire extinguishers, replace batteries flashlights twice a year)
  • Safeguard copies of important documents
